This was a great hotel for our visit to the Black Hills. It is centrally located to Mt Rushmore and Crazy Horse so we were not spending a bunch of time in the car. It is also about a 30 minute drive to Rapid City. We stayed in the suite room which was great. There were 6 of us and... more

We had a very large room with 1 private bedroom, 2 doubles and kitchenette. It was very roomy and comfortable. It was in the same building as the indoor pool, which we also enjoyed. The office and restaurant were across the parking lot. Food was pretty good but wish they would've had a discount for hotel guests. The location was... more

We stayed here for two nights while visiting Mt. Rushmore. The beds in this hotel are horrible. I don't know how anyone can sleep on them. The walls are paper thin and we heard every single person that passed by our room. The location is not that great, given that just about every single restaurant/store was closed for the season.... more
